Using Epoxy Putty To Fill Cracks In Old Plank FloorFilling the cracks with a non flexible wood putty almost always results in the putty cracking out Wood moves with the change of indoor humidity and the dry hard putty filler does not So when the wood is the narrowest in the middle of winter heating season, the putty falls out.Hardwood Floor Gaps & CracksWhat Filler Will Fix My Gapped Floors? How? Unfortunately no filler will work effectively unless the humidity level is kept constant During the expansion process when warmer days allow for houses to be open to outside air, gapping will close up as the wood flooring takes on moisture and the filler eventually gets squeezed out.How to fix laminate flooring gapsHow to fix laminate flooring gaps The gaps between the laminate planks create a poor appearance and might damage the flooring, if you don’t take action quickly Nevertheless, there are situation in which the gaps are just to large to be able to fix them without reinstalling the laminate planks.2019 Best Wood Fillers ReviewsWood Filler Reviews In your home wood gets damaged and needs to be repaired or replaced When the dog scratches the frame of the door, instead of replacing the frame, select a wood filler that will get the job done quickly and at a lower expense than replacing the wood.How To Fix Cracks in Old Wood Floor?Apr 17, 2012· Q My apartment (rental) was built in the 1880’s and the floor has never been renovated the uneven wood floors are painted white and have cracks and large gaps between them,I have always loved my floor but now I am pregnant and while I may cover the floor in the bedroom I am trying to find a way to fix the cracks & holes (some as big as 1 to 2 inches wide) without having to spend a.How to Use Epoxy on Wood for RepairsFill the Wood Cavity with Exterior Wood Filler Family Handyman Press the putty like wood rot epoxy filler into the repair area with a putty knife Press hard to fill all voids and ensure a good bond TIP Don’t waste wood rot epoxy when you’re making large or deep repairs Cut or carve blocks of wood to fill most of the cavity.How to Repair Cracks in the Wood on My DeckHow to Repair Cracks in the Wood on My Deck , With a putty knife, fill any cracks in the wood that are under 4 inches in length with a latex wood filler that is formulated for outdoor application and will not shrink, crack or flake when exposed to rain and sun , How to Repair Bulging Floor Boards 6.Filling Large Gaps in Wood FloorWood filling the pits and cracks We just bought an old house with beautiful wood floors and trim However, the floors are VERY pitted and cracked in large high traffic areas, though fairly solid (ie, not creaking or moving a lot).Wood FillerShop Wood Filler at acehardware and get Free Store Pickup at your neighborhood Ace Buy Online & Pickup Today See Details.[HELP] Should I fill in all of these spaces in hardwood floor?The only unanimous professional opinion I could get on filling in cracks is using wood putty that has been blended with other colors to get the perfect color match I'm by no means a professional but I did a ton of research and most pros seemed to be against using this approach for filling in cracks.Best Wood Filler for Hardwood FloorsMay 17, 2011· Filling cracks in wood floor I have a hard maple wood floor that's 80 years old The boards are 1 1/2" wide and have shrunk from 1/32" to 1/4" inch Is their a way to fill the cracks?
